Community Engagement Through Sports

Additionally, community-based sports initiatives have gained momentum in Canada. Organizations like Sport for Life are at the forefront of promoting engagement among youth through workshops and programs that emphasize skill development, teamwork, and healthy lifestyles. Such initiatives play a critical role in shaping positive sporting life experiences and reducing barriers to access for underrepresented communities.

Youth participation has surged in various sports such as hockey, basketball, and soccer, with local clubs reporting increased enrollment. This trend highlights the vital links between sporting life, social interaction, and youth health and well-being in a post-pandemic environment.
